attached is patch for a bug fix in the file inifcns_nstdsums.cpp.
This bug is not related to any bug reported in January.
The bug manifest itself that G-functions with trailing zeros and y<>1 are 
not calculated correctly.

Description:

The method G_do_hoelder is called from the method G_numeric.
G_do_hoelder expects arguments without trailing zeros.
(The reason is that G_do_hoelder uses the scaling relation, which is only 
valid for G-functions without trailing zeros.)
Trailing zeros are handled by the method G_do_trafo.
The patch ensures that the method G_numeric calls in the case of trailing 
zeros the method G_do_trafo and not G_hoelder.
